Time Project

'De-Generations': Aging animated characters exhibited in a digital cage.






Animated characters are timeless. Only in rare occasions we watch them grow older (for example, Simba in The Lion King movie), but overall their great advantage is the timeless aspect of their presence.

Based on an idea first seen by The Golden Age series of animations by Augenblick Studios, I intend to display four animated characters sitting still on a timeless outdoor setting. We will witness them evolve in a period of their lives (child to teenager, or young man to middle-aged man, middle-aged woman to old woman).
Time aspect:
- Remove and add atributes to drawings... avoid massive animation, add the aging feature. The animated characters will not move much, almost as if they were posing for a drawing class. They will look at the camera, blink, eventually change pose, but they will feel almost like a static object. The animation will focus, slowly and gradually, on their aging process. The idea is to show the viewers the features we deem impossible to attribute to animated characters, hence bringing them to a more realistic realm.
The lack of 'action' or plot, other than sitting down and aging, once again defeats the alleged purpose of having a character animated. The video seeks to be universal, easy to convey its message in any language, and more of a reflection piece than a story. The human body's evolution in life is the story itself.
Characters:
1. Young man, on the beach. Age from ages 21 to 55
2. Middle-aged woman, in a forest. From ages 40 to 67
3. Boy, on the snow, from 7 to 18
4. Teenage girl, desert, ages 14 to 29
Soundtrack
Ambient sound (a beach, the forest)
Exhibit Set-up
Three screens, playing simultaneously, their individual soundtracks
Online set-up
The option to play them individually or all together.


Questions to consider:
- Should the animated characters also become young? Should video replay or play backwards once the character has aged?
- Would it be interesting to show one character from being born to dying a long life, including the decay process?
- Nude or clothed?
